Introduction to ECG Technology in Smartwatches

In today's fast-paced world, health monitoring technology has become increasingly relevant, especially in wearables like smartwatches. One of the most promising features that has been recently unearthed within certain Android applications is the ECG functionality, which stands for electrocardiogram.

This technology allows users to monitor their heart health more conveniently than ever before, providing real-time data on vital heart functions. With advancements in mobile technology, wearable devices are now capable of performing complex health assessments usually reserved for clinics and hospitals.

The integration of ECG capabilities in smartwatches signifies a landmark achievement in personal health monitoring, addressing various cardiac conditions. From detecting high or low heart rates to identifying serious rhythm issues like atrial fibrillation, this technology empowers users to take charge of their heart health.

ECG readings can also identify premature ventricular contractions (PVCs), which may indicate underlying issues or conditions requiring medical attention. This feature positions smartwatches as vital health monitoring tools that can alert users to potential health risks.

OnePlus Watch: A Brief Overview

OnePlus made waves in the wearable market with their first smartwatch, the OnePlus Watch. With a sleek design and multiple fitness tracking functions, it garnered significant attention from tech enthusiasts.

During our comprehensive review of the OnePlus Watch 2, we awarded it an impressive 4.5 out of 5 stars. The watch was praised for its aesthetics, functionality, and user experience, making it a solid competitor in the wearable sector.

As OnePlus embarks on the development of its successor, expectations are running high regarding the features and enhancements it will bring to the table. Insights suggest that upcoming models may incorporate advanced health functionalities, making them crucial devices for health monitoring.

The anticipation for the OnePlus Watch 3 is palpable, especially among those who value both style and substance in a wearable device. Consumers are eager to see how OnePlus will refine its offerings in response to user feedback.

One potential highlight of the upcoming release is the rumored OnePlus Watch 3 Pro version. The Pro edition is expected to boast enhanced features and improved performance, catering to high-demand users.

Understanding Heart Health Monitoring

Monitoring heart health is crucial for detecting and preventing potential cardiovascular issues, which are becoming increasingly prevalent in today's society. The introduction of ECG technology in smartwatches brings this critical health information to the fingertips of users.

Frequent heart rate monitoring allows individuals to identify normal and abnormal patterns, signaling when medical consultation may be necessary. For instance, consistent high or low readings may indicate an underlying health issue that requires further investigation.

ECG functionality serves as a non-invasive method for assessing heart rhythms in real time. Unlike traditional methods, which often involve prolonged clinical tests, ECG from wearables provides users with immediate feedback.

Smartwatches equipped with ECG can facilitate timely interventions, potentially saving lives. Individuals who experience symptoms such as palpitations can use their devices to conduct immediate ECG readings.

The insights gained from these readings can empower users to make informed decisions regarding their health, promoting a proactive approach to wellness. Being able to share ECG data with healthcare providers enhances the quality of medical consultations.

Additionally, the data collected can aid in the ongoing assessment of chronic conditions, allowing for adjusted treatments as necessary. This level of personalized care bridges the gap between technology and healthcare, fostering better patient outcomes.
